Wondering what you will eat at the new T-Mobile Arena after it opens on April 6? Parent company MGM Resorts brought on Levy Restaurants to handle the food at the 20,000-seat arena that opens with The Killers performing.
Pizza Forte from the Ferraro’s family continues with its expansion, opening inside the arena with New York-style pizza, Hofmann sausages and hot dogs. Pizza Forte already has locations at Sunset Station and the Hard Rock Hotel.
Levy also plans to change up the menu depending on what fans want to eat. The could mean pork hoisin bahn mi, a made-to-order ahi tuna poke bar and club lounges that feature craft beer, duck fat frites and artisanal charcuterie.
Those event level suites plans to serve up small plates with cheeses and pastas, and sandwiches and frites samplers "reflecting regional American flavors."
Suite owners can pick out their own menus that feature dishes such as caviar, fried chicken, filet mignon and Tiki ribs. Levy says the menus will feature heritage meats, sustainable seafood and organic vegetables.
